ABOUT THIS POSITION

The Street Transportation Department is seeking a motivated individual for a Civil Engineer III position within the Office of the City Engineer. The Vertical Project Management (VPM) section within the Office of the City Engineer is responsible for overseeing and managing the design and construction of Capital Improvement Projects (CIP) for various city departments. The VPM section is involved in all stages of these projects, from initial planning and design through construction and the warranty period. Typical projects include the design, construction, and renovation of municipal buildings, police and fire facilities, libraries, parks, and other municipal capital improvement projects.

The Civil Engineer III will oversee the design and construction of various projects for the city. This position involves managing a diverse portfolio of municipal construction and renovation projects, with a primary focus on the design and construction of new municipal buildings, tenant improvements, and upgrades to parks infrastructure .
